Hi, thank you for the suggestions.
Main problem is the low input inpedence of my iraudamp, and then a passive preamp is not enough ( i did try it). A small gain is needed to get full potential of the amp.
Anyway, in my latest version, i have added an opa2134 to do a balanced input mode, mainly for bridging capabilities, and it have something like 47kohm of input load, while the output got like 100ohm impedence, so it will get no difficulties to drive the amp. I havent assembled the final board, but initial test shows quite good performance, the opa is a very good opamp, and seems at home on this design.
Then maybe a passive preamp will work ok, i didnt try it on this final design. My Luxman tube CD player got a motorized potentiometer at one of its output, it is my passive preamp 😀
